Gilbertti thinks Nakamura’s issues are more related to him not being able to speak English effectively. He thinks Nakamura lost his appeal the minute he opened his mouth.

He goes on to say that a lot of Mexican wrestlers have come and gone in WWE without appealing to the mainstream audience, but Alberto Del Rio was able to come in and get over because he can speak English well. Gilbertti doesn’t understand why WWE refused to pair Nakamura with Paul Heyman because that was a natural pairing in his mind.

Russo was embarrassed for The Young Bucks who sent out a video of themselves wrestling Santa in their living room on Christmas Day. He says that display represented such a high level of ‘markism’ and he can’t even begin to imagine Steve Austin doing something like that at the height of his success. He doesn’t understand why The Bucks couldn’t just enjoy Christmas with their family and friends without thinking about wrestling 24/7.
